Форум на Kuban.ru (http://forums.kuban.ru/)
-   Территория 1С (http://forums.kuban.ru/f1544/)
-   -   Управляемые формы. реквизит формы списка (http://forums.kuban.ru/f1544/upravlyaemye_formy_rekvizit_formy_spiska-5136532.html)

vodoley_ol 11.12.2013 12:33

Управляемые формы. реквизит формы списка
 
Как установить значение реквизита формы списка справочника или документа, чтобы при выводе списка этот реквизит заполнялся динамически, храниться он не должен. В обычном приложении для этого была процедура "ПриВыводеСтроки".

roma n 11.12.2013 14:35

Источник - произвольный запрос

vodoley_ol 11.12.2013 14:40

(1) при помощи запроса это я видел

vodoley_ol 11.12.2013 14:41

+(1) а есть ли способ полностью при помощи кода заполнить значение реквизита

Uho 12.12.2013 09:35

а задача то какая?

vodoley_ol 12.12.2013 10:06

(4) Например есть справочник "Контрагенты" в списке добавляю реквизит "Договор" другой реквизит "Р/с"
при выводе списка нужно заполнять Есть или нет у конкретного контрагента договор. расчетный счет
плюс к этому нужно раскрасить (условное оформление сделать) по этим условиям.

Привел элементарный пример, который решается запросом. в итоге так и сделал.
Может возникнуть ситуация, где простым запросом не обойдешься - расчет какого-то параметра в списке документов

в обычном приложении при помощи "ПриВыводеСтроки" я что хотел то и использовал, хотел запросом. хотел кодом или смешанный вариант
вот и вопрос если ли возможность в управляемых формах использовать "смешанный вариант"?

Reaper 12.12.2013 10:19

"ПриВыводеСтроки" нужно использовать как причину увольнения. И только.

roma n 12.12.2013 15:21

Суров. Однако её не зря оставили в языке

Reaper 12.12.2013 15:25

7-roma n >Исключительно для совместимости.

roma n 12.12.2013 17:34

8-Reaper > Хм...
Был у меня образчик, где ПриПолученииДанных вызывалось запредельное количество раз при построении списка документов (или RLS, или отборы, или и то и другое заставляли платформу дёргаться),- список открывался более 5 минут. Есть у меня ощущение что ПриВыводеСтроки будет предпочтительнее, но утверждать не буду. Надо бы вспомнить с чем там этот ручник связан был... если найду копию - проверю...


Текущее время: 20:14. Часовой пояс GMT +3.